Charles Evans Hughes, Sgro v. United States — Opinion of the Court
“ Counsel for the United States submit that while under the Espionage Act (section 11) a search warrant not executed within ten days becomes invalid, the statute does not inhibit utilization of an outlawed warrant as a mere form or blank when preparing a new one based upon the original affidavit; that here the act of the Commissioner in changing the date upon the July 6th warrant and then reissuing it under date of July 27th was to all intents and purposes the issuing of an entirely new and valid warrant supported by the Dodd affidavit of July 6th. ”
